Sankey charts are a unique and powerful tool for visualizing complex data flows and network relationships. These diagrams excel at illustrating the flow of work, energy, or resources across networks and systems, making them invaluable for understanding interconnected data sets. By mapping the magnitude of flows over time, Sankey charts help uncover insights and patterns that are often hidden in traditional visual formats.
At their core, Sankey charts resemble arrows that follow the pathway of goods, services, or information. Each arrow’s width represents the magnitude of the flow it represents, creating a visual comparison of data intensity that conventional bar charts or pie graphs simply can’t achieve. This makes them particularly useful in a variety of fields, including systems engineering, transportation, waste management, and energy analysis.
To get started with Sankey charts, let’s delve into some key components that distinguish them from other types of visualizations:
### Flow Representation
Sankey charts rely on arrows to depict the flow of data from one element to another. Arrow width is directly correlated with the volume of the flow, which is a core feature that separates Sankey diagrams from other visual formats.
### Efficiency in Space
These charts are designed to efficiently use their display area by having arrows follow paths that take up as little space as possible. This space-saving property allows for the representation of numerous data points and flows within a limited space.
### Alignment
Another key feature is that the paths along which the flow moves are typically aligned close to one another, allowing the eye to compare flow magnitudes easily. This alignment is crucial for ascertaining similarities and differences in data flow strengths.
To create a Sankey chart, follow these general steps:
1. **Identify the Key Elements**: Begin by identifying the inputs, processes, and outputs that make up your data system or network.
2. **Gather Data**: Collect the quantities flowing between the elements in your network.
3. **Choose Software or Tools**: Select a suitable software tool that supports Sankey chart creation. Some programs allow you to import data directly to form a Sankey chart.
4. **Configure the Chart**: Adjust the chart’s elements and flows to suit your specific data and objectives.
5. **Analyze and Present**: Once the Sankey chart is rendered, take time to analyze it, interpret the relationships, and communicate your findings effectively.
Benefits of using Sankey charts include:
– **Enhanced Data Understanding**: By visualizing the relationships and flows in a network, Sankey charts can help highlight unexpected relationships and areas for optimization.
– **Comparative Analysis**: They facilitate a straightforward comparison of different flows and help users quickly identify which areas are dominant or deserve further investigation.
– **Data-Driven Storytelling**: A well-crafted Sankey chart can communicate complex ideas and patterns in a compelling and digestible manner.
Despite these benefits, there are some limitations worth noting:
– **Complexity:** Sankey charts are best suited for depicting linear flows; however, representing multidimensional or circular flows can become overly complex.
– **Limited Text Labeling**: With such a considerable focus on the visual representation of flow intensity, incorporating text labels for each element can clutter the chart and impact readability.
Using Sankey charts effectively can transform the way you look at and explain data flow in networks. By showcasing the intricate details of how systems operate and resources move, these diagrams provide actionable insights and serve as an essential tool in the data visualization toolkit.